Transaction 8d3c3033fbd90fb42e746f411f350d71b9905f8c724be45ef5c24ef1963467c6

1 Input
2 Outputs
  • 8d3c3033fbd90fb42e746f411f350d71b9905f8c724be45ef5c24ef1963467c6:0
  • value  33243576
    address  16inbLVLkSAaTKDo3jnxsAx5GwwP2KWcPS
  • 8d3c3033fbd90fb42e746f411f350d71b9905f8c724be45ef5c24ef1963467c6:1
  • value  412900953
    address  37MDYhc7Yekn5DkwRGNBPWgTeZAgAHet5u